Xavier's School For Gifted Youngsters

A private boarding school in Salem Center, New York is in reality a training facility for heroic mutant advocacy and activism for peaceful coexistence between humans and mutants. Unknown to the public, senior students and graduates of the school have become crisis intervention specialists affectionately known as the X-MEN.

In the dawn of the final decade of the 20th century, a disease known as the Legacy Virus threatens to eradicate the mutant population. The virus becomes a global pandemic that even Charles Xavier and his First Class have fallen victim to. But before the Legacy Virus claims them, their bodies are preserved in stasis until a cure can be discovered. The lone survivor is Jean Grey, who takes on the role of Headmistress of Xavier's School while continuing the work of the X-Men.

During this trying time, Jean looks beyond the walls of the academy and she begins to recruit mutants from wherever she is able to find them in order to form an ALTERNATE CLASS. It is hoped these new mutants will continue the fight for the future of peaceful coexistence between mutants and humans, and perhaps discover a cure for the Legacy Virus.
